Roche Bobois shares gained more than 3% on the Paris Bourse on Friday, after reporting a new sales "record" for the 2022 financial year.

The high-end home furnishings brand said last year that revenues were up 22.3% (+17.4% at constant exchange rates) to 408.5 million euros, well above its announced target of 385 million euros.

In a press release, the family-owned company - which also owns the Cuir Center chain - explains this "historic" performance by the worldwide appeal of its brand and the success of its latest collections.

On the strength of this level of activity, Roche Bobois confirms its objective of strong growth in Ebitda in 2022, a prospect which led it to pay an interim dividend of one euro per share last December in anticipation of this remarkable year.

In view of these factors, the company anticipates further growth in sales in the first half of 2023.
